Responsibilities

  • Providing comprehensive "cradle-to-grave" acquisition support across all phases: pre-award, solicitation, evaluation, award, and post-award.
  • Assisting program offices with acquisition planning, including developing milestone schedules, market research, and Independent Government Cost Estimates (IGCEs).
  • Preparing procurement packages such as Statements of Work (SOW), Performance Work Statements (PWS), and Justifications for Other than Full and Open Competition (JOFOCs).
  • Using the PRISM contract writing system to prepare solicitations (RFPs/RFQs/IFBs) and award documents for Contracting Officer release.
  • Supporting Technical Evaluation Boards by documenting findings, performing cost/price analysis, and drafting source selection decision memoranda.
  • Managing post-award actions, including Contracting Officer's Representative (COR) designation letters, contract modifications, and full contract closeout per FAR 4.804
